Job Title: Power Platform Developer
Location: Kansas City, MO
Duties and Responsibilities
• Design, build, configure, test, deploy and maintain solutions built within the Microsoft Power Platform. Develop reusable components, scripts and frameworks designed to replicate manual administrative processes.
• Partner with Business Analysts to lead internal stakeholders to identify opportunities by analyzing and understanding business problems, processes and data.
• Document technical designs, release notes, and other project documentation to support development, security, operations, and maintenance.
• Create Power BI reports using DAX or M, utilizing multiple data sources with different permissions and structures to provide a seamless end-user experience.
• Iteratively collaborate across colleagues, customers and third-parties during product development and QA to make sure it fits design and solves business problems.
• Deploy projects successfully and problem-solve issues that arise in day-to-day support by providing timely responses and solutions as required.
• Help develop standards and best practices for solutions built within the power platform including governance, operating model and solutions.
• Collect and interpret data, analyze results and report findings to internal or external stakeholders.
• Bring a passion to stay on top of tech trends and best practices: experiment with and learn new technologies, participate in community of practice groups, and mentor other members of the community.
• Estimate projects based on scope and level of effort, provide timely communication of progress and completion.
• Create Virtual Agents to assist users with smaller tasks or scale for repeated tasks for the broader department.
• Perform other work as assigned.
Education and Experience Requirements:
•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Science, IT, MIS, Engineering, or related fields or relevant equivalent experience and certifications.
• Experienced software engineer or developer candidates will be considered for this role, with the ideal candidate having at least four years of related experience.
• Hands on experience on with the Power Platform (Power Apps, Power Automate, Power Virtual Agents, Dataverse, PowerBI, etc.) or other low-code / no-code platforms is preferred.
• Programming or development experience (R, Python, Java, .Net, C#, Visual Basic, etc.) preferably on automation and/or integration projects is preferred.
• Experience and knowledge of Microsoft Power BI or similar applications a plus.
